When the Montana Grizzlies face Eastern Washington Saturday in Cheney, Wash., two of the best running backs in the Football Championship Subdivision ranks will be on the new red turf.

And while UM coach Robin Pflugrad wouldn’t trade his own Chase Reynolds for any other running back, he’s also candid when it comes to evaluating pure talent.

“Right now, Taiwan Jones is head and shoulders above anybody at our level,” said Pflugrad, referring to EWU’s speedy 6-1, 200-pound junior. “Every time he touches the ball he’s a threat to do it all. You look at the hit chart and they’re nobody else like him, a guy who can make long-distance runs and swing passes from anywhere on the field.”

Jones currently leads the nation in all-purpose yardage (278.5 yards per game), is 10th in rushing (117 ypg) and fourth in scoring (12 ppg). He is averaging an astounding 9 yards per carry.
